Tomiichi Murayama, Former Japanese Prime Minister and Architect of Historic War Apology, Passes Away at 101


In a televised address marking the 50th anniversary of Japan's surrender, the prime minister expressed the nation's "deep remorse" over wartime atrocities.

The speech aimed to acknowledge the impact of Japan's actions during the war and to reflect on the lessons learned from that period in history.

This commemoration serves as a significant moment for Japan, highlighting the importance of remembrance and reconciliation in the context of international relations.
